There are different techniques to carry out a skin biopsy. Your dermatologist will select one of the strategies listed here, relying on the area of the cured location as well as the sort of skin growth to be assessed:: a surgical blade is used to cut a shallow piece of either component of the growth or the whole development.If the shave biopsy goes deeper right into the skin, the resulting mark will certainly be more visible as skin dr near me well as the shape of the mark will certainly be the shape of the skin biopsy.: a tiny round instrument is utilized to cut either component of the development or the whole growth. The resulting wound is usually sewn side-by-side.
Because the injury is typically stitched, the resulting scar is linear. If nondissolvable stitches are made use of, they will certainly be gotten rid of within 1 to 2 weeks after the biopsy, depending on the location of the dealt with area.: a surgical blade is made use of to entirely remove the growth. The resulting wound is usually stitched alongside.
